My Portfolio

Web Development Projects

Welcome to my portfolio showcasing interactive web applications

Professional Journey

Andrew is a results-oriented software engineer with proven skills in web development, systems engineering, and workflow automation. With a strong academic background in Computer Science and practical experience in Python, and containerised development, he creates scalable and maintainable solutions that simplify complex processes while enhancing user experiences.

By specialising in process automation, Docker-based environments, and data manipulation, Andrew optimises infrastructure and streamlines development pipelines to improve efficiency and reduce technical overhead. His meticulous approach reliably produces systems designed for long-term scalability, cross-platform compatibility, and operational clarity.

Showcase Portfolio

Numbers Downs - Math Quiz Game

Numbers Down

A countdown numbers quiz game where players solve mathematical puzzles.

Interactive gameplay Math challenges
Flowchart Builder - Visual Process Diagrams

Flowchart Builder

Build interactive flowcharts and audit responses. A tool for creating visual process diagrams with validation capabilities.

Drag-and-drop interface Response validation Export functionality Audit trail
Wordle Assistant - Word Game Helper

Wordle Assistant

A helper tool for solving Wordle puzzles. Input your guesses and get suggestions for your next move.

Word suggestions Pattern recognition Strategy tips
Passphrases Generator - Secure Password Creation

Passphrases Generator

Generate secure, memorable passphrases for better online security. Customizable options for length and complexity. See how rearrange the words changes the phrase.

Secure generation Customisation options